Our Flat Removals Process
1. Enquiry & Quote
You contact us with basic details: current address, destination, flat size, access information and your preferred moving date. We then provide a clear, no-obligation quotation, outlining what is included so you know exactly what to expect.
2. Survey – Virtual or Onsite
For most flat moves we carry out a short video or phone survey to understand access, parking and inventory. For larger or more complex moves, we can arrange an onsite visit. This helps us allocate the right size vehicle, team and equipment on the day.
3. Packing & Preparation
We offer both full packing services and part packing services. Our team can professionally pack your entire flat, or just fragile and high-value items such as glassware, artwork and electronics. We use quality packing materials and can supply boxes in advance if you prefer to pack yourself.
4. Loading & Transport
On moving day, our trained team arrives on time, protects floors and communal areas, and carefully carries everything to the vehicle. Furniture is wrapped and secured; mattresses and sofas are protected. We then transport your belongings directly to your new address in purpose-equipped removal vehicles.
5. Unloading & Placement
At your new flat, we unload items to the rooms you choose, placing furniture where you want it. For customers using our dismantling service, we can also reassemble beds and other agreed items. Before leaving, we walk through with you to ensure everything is in the right place.

How far in advance should I book my flat removal?
Ideally, book as soon as you have a confirmed moving date, particularly if you are moving on a Friday, at month-end or during the summer when demand is higher. Two to four weeks’ notice is typical, but we often accommodate moves on shorter timescales. Early booking allows us to arrange parking, building access and any additional services such as packing. If your date is not yet fixed, we can still discuss your requirements and hold provisional arrangements where possible.
